Monday Accident & Lessons Learned: Fatal Accident at James Street Station, Liverpool

The UK Rail Accident Investigation Branch posted a new report on a recent accident. Here’s the summary by the UK RAIB and a link to the full report.

The RAIB concluded its accident investigation in October 2012 and provided embargoed copies of its report to those involved, to enable them to start acting on its safety recommendations immediately.

The Crown Prosecution Service asked the RAIB to delay publication of its report until after the trial of the guard involved in the accident, so the RAIB did not make it available on its website at that time.

The RAIB released the report after the guard’s trial concluded in November 2012. The report makes three recommendations.
